APTGF500U60D4 Single switch NPT IGBT Power Module VCES = 600V IC = 500A Tc = 80°C Application • Welding converters • Switched Mode Power Supplies • Uninterruptible Power Supplies • Motor control Features • Non Punch Through NPT fast IGBT - Low voltage drop - Low tail current - Switching frequency up to 50 kHz - Soft recovery parallel diodes - Low diode VF - Low leakage current - Avalanche energy rated - RBSOA and SCSOA rated • Kelvin emitter for easy drive • Low stray inductance - M6 connectors for power - M4 connectors for signal • High level of integration Benefits • Outstanding performance at high frequency operation • Stable temperature behavior • Very rugged • Direct mounting to heatsink isolated package • Low junction to case thermal resistance • Easy paralleling due to positive TC of VCEsat Absolute maximum ratings Parameter Max ratings Unit VCES Collector - Emitter Breakdown Voltage IC Continuous Collector Current TC = 25°C TC = 80°C ICM Pulsed Collector Current TC = 25°C VGE Gate Emitter Voltage ±20 PD Maximum Power Dissipation TC = 25°C 2000 Tj = 125°C These Devices are sensitive to Electrostatic Discharge. Proper Handing Procedures Should Be Followed.
